x.ai features and specs

  • Automated Scheduling
    X.ai automates the process of scheduling meetings, which saves time and reduces the back-and-forth often involved in finding mutually available time slots.
  • User-Friendly Interface
    The platform offers an intuitive interface that makes it easy for users to set up and manage schedules.
  • Integration Capabilities
    X.ai integrates seamlessly with popular calendar systems such as Google Calendar and Microsoft Outlook, enhancing its usability.
  • Customization Options
    Users can customize their scheduling preferences and availability, allowing greater control over how meetings are arranged.
  • Time Zone Management
    The tool effectively manages different time zones, making it easier to schedule meetings with international participants.

Possible disadvantages of x.ai

  • Cost
    X.ai comes with a subscription fee, which may be prohibitive for small businesses or individual users with limited budgets.
  • Learning Curve
    While the interface is user-friendly, there can be a learning curve for new users to fully take advantage of all its features.
  • Dependency on External Calendars
    Since X.ai relies on integration with external calendars, any issues with these calendar services can affect its performance.
  • Privacy Concerns
    Some users may have concerns over privacy and data security, as sensitive scheduling information is processed through the platform.
  • Limited Human Interaction
    The automated nature of X.ai means there is less human interaction, which could be a downside for those who prefer a more personal touch when scheduling meetings.

GitHub features and specs

  • collaboration
    GitHub provides a platform for multiple developers to work on the same project concurrently, facilitating collaboration through features like pull requests, code reviews, and issues tracking.
  • integration
    GitHub integrates seamlessly with various third-party tools and services, such as CI/CD pipelines, project management tools, and many development environments, enhancing productivity and workflow efficiency.
  • version_control
    Utilizes Git for version control, allowing users to track changes, revert to previous versions if necessary, and manage different branches of development, ensuring code stability and history tracking.
  • community
    With millions of developers and a vast repository of open-source projects, GitHub fosters a robust community where users can contribute to projects, seek help, share knowledge, and collaborate broadly.
  • availability
    GitHub is a cloud-based platform, which means that projects are accessible from anywhere with an internet connection, providing flexibility and convenience to developers globally.
  • documentation
    GitHub allows for comprehensive project documentation through README files, wikis, and GitHub Pages, making it easier for users to understand project context and contribute effectively.

Possible disadvantages of GitHub

  • cost
    While GitHub offers free plans, more advanced features and private repositories come at a cost, which might be a barrier for some individuals or small teams.
  • steep_learning_curve
    For newcomers, especially those unfamiliar with Git, the learning curve can be quite steep, making it challenging to utilize all of GitHub's features effectively.
  • privacy_concerns
    Given its expansive, open nature, users must be cautious with sensitive or proprietary information. Even with private repositories, there is a latent concern over data privacy and security.
  • interface_complexity
    The user interface, while powerful, can be overwhelming and complex for beginners or those not deeply familiar with version control concepts.
  • performance_issues
    Occasionally, GitHub may experience downtime or performance issues, which can disrupt workflow and prevent access to repositories temporarily.
  • limited_storage
    GitHub imposes limitations on storage space and file size within repositories, which can be restrictive for projects requiring large datasets or binaries.
